Advisory Board Texas Parents is governed by an Advisory Board made up of about 75 couples and single parents. Advisory Board members serve a two-year, renewable term as ambassadors for The University of Texas at Austin, assist in planning activities for UT families and support the goals and objectives of Texas Parents. Advisory Board members are expected to maintain a membership in Texas Parents, attend the fall and spring Board meetings, and volunteer at one or more sessions of Family Orientation and/or Family Weekend. They are also expected to participate on one committee of their choice and in the annual membership drive.
